What are the system requirements for RUN: The world in-between on PC?
To run RUN: The world in-between on your PC, you need at least a 64bit 1.5 GHz CPU processor and a OpenGL 3.0 (DirectX® 10) compliant graphics card and driver graphics card. For the best experience, a 64bit Multi-core 2GHz CPU CPU and OpenGL 3.0 (DirectX® 10) compliant graphics card and driver GPU are recommended. The game also requires a minimum of 2048 MB RAM RAM, 300 MB available space of disk space, — as your operating system, and DirectX 10.
